Meanwhile, the PTA has also stated that the Central Board of Revenue has revised duty drawback rates for goods manufactured from cow, buffalo or camel hides from fob 2.88% to 2.5%, leather garments from 5.33% to 5.24% and leather articles and made-ups using imported wet blue hides and skins have been revised from 1.78% to 1%.
